WebOct 31, 2016 · Eating a heart-healthy diet is important for managing your blood pressure and reducing your risk of heart attack, stroke and other health threats. Get quality nutrition from healthy food sources Aim to eat a diet that's rich in: Fruits Vegetables Whole-grains Low-fat dairy products Skinless poultry and fish Nuts and legumes
